How they compare
Colombia currently reports 235,454 against 207,503 in Kazakhstan, a difference of 27,951.
That makes Colombia's figure about 1.1 times Kazakhstan's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 33 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Colombia ahead.
Colombia ranks 29th and Kazakhstan ranks 31st of 116 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Colombia averaged higher in 2 and Kazakhstan in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Colombia | Kazakhstan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 84,174 | 5,110 | 79,064 | Colombia |
| 2000s | 63,709 | 52,813 | 10,896 | Colombia |
| 2010s | 84,695 | 207,948 | 123,252 | Kazakhstan |
| 2020s | 163,445 | 232,059 | 68,614 | Kazakhstan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
